South Africa's unemployment rate has hit a record high from 34.4%, according to the quarterly labour force survey in the second quarter of 2021, to 34.9 in the third quarter. Economist Duma Gqubule wrote that the unemployment crisis in South Africa is the most heart-breaking betrayal of the promises and dreams of liberation. Gqubule says after years of failed economic policies, the time has come to change course and learn the lessons of economic development that have enabled some countries to transform their economies in one generation. He points out that there is a solution to the problem if the government is prepared to mobilise its resources.
